Mark Wahlberg won the Generation Award at Sunday's MTV Movie Awards, and during his acceptance speech managed to work in references to "Entourage," Bubba Watson, the Funky Bunch, Penny Marshall, "Ted 2," Charles Bronson's "Hard Times" and Palm Sunday. There were also a surfeit of swears that MTV managed to bleep out. "This is America," Wahlberg said during the speech, "and anything is possible."
